Kings XI Punjab defeated Delhi Daredevils at the picturesque stadium at Dharamsala. Delhi Daredvils captain James Hopes won the toss and put KXIP to bat. Paul Valthaty (62 runs off 50 balls) and Shaun Marsh (46 runs off 28 balls) capitalized on the terrible fielding and catching of Delhi Daredevils today as they got numerous lives and took KXIP to 170/6 in 20 overs. Irfan Pathan took 3 wickets for Delhi Daredevils while Aavishkar Salvi took 2 wickets. In reply, DD started slowly and then kept on losing wickets as they ended up with 141/8 in 20 overs. Piyush Chawla took 3 wickets for KXIP while Shalabh Srivastava took 2 wickets. Piyush Chawla was awarded the Man of the Match for his 3 wickets for 16 runs in 4 overs.

Chennai Super Kings defeated Delhi Daredevils by 18 runs at Chepauk, Chennai. CSK captain MS Dhoni won the toss and decided to bat. Mahendra Singh Dhoni played a blistering knock of 63 runs not out off 31 balls and he was supported by Subramanium Badrinath who scored 55 runs off 43 balls as CSK posted 176/4 in 20 overs. In reply, Delhi Daredevils kept on losing wickets and Irfan Pathan was the lone ranger as he scored 44 not out off 34 balls as DD ended up at 158/6 in 20 overs. R Ashwin and Dwayne Bravo scalped 2 wickets apiece for CSK. Chennai skipper Dhoni was awarded the Man of the Match for his blistering knock.

Mumbai Indians defeated Delhi Daredevils by 32 runs at the Wankhede Stadium, Mumbai. DD captain Sehwag won the toss and put Mumbai Indians to bat. Ambati Rayudu (59 runs off 39 balls), Rohit Sharma (49 runs off 32 balls) and Adrien Blizzard (37 runs off 23 balls) helped MI score a massive total of 178/4 in 20 overs. In reply, Delhi Daredevils lost their top 4 in just 7 runs but James Hopes (55 runs off 44 balls), Venugopal Rao (37 runs off 27 balls) and Irfan Pathan (23 runs off 18 balls) helped them somewhat recover though DD finally got all out for 146 runs in 19.5 overs. Lasith Malinga, Munaf Patel, Harbhajan Singh and Keiron Pollard took 2 wickets each for the Mumbai Indians. Ambati Rayudu was awarded the Man of the Match for his knock and agility behind the stumps as well.

Kolkata Knight Riders had been losing almost all matches and it has been engulfed by controversies too in IPL 2. This match was very crucial for them to make in the semi finals of IPL T20 season 2. Brendon McCullum won the toss and elected to bat. Kolkata Knight Riders reached a score of 153/3 in 20 overs due to a brilliant innings by Brad Hodge (70 off 43 balls). Kings XI Punjab chased down the score quiet easily helped by Mahela Jayawardena’s innings of 52 runs off 41 balls and a lot of dropped catches by the KKR fielders. It went down to the last ball of the match and Punjab reached 154/4 in 20 overs. Mahela Jayawardena was awarded the Man of the Match for his brilliant innings.
